    What cost the Caps:
    1) Semin is a joke. The final Tampa goal illustrates it perfectly. Semin gets knocked down and stands in the zone bitching at the ref then slowly skates back to the bench for the change while he watches St Louis break down the ice and score. He isn't committed to defense, disappears offensively for long stretches of games and in my opinion needs other players to make the plays for him while he cashes in the goal rather than being a pure playmaker.
    2) Mike Green, Carloson, et al.: If you are going to switch to a defensive system, it helps to have defenseman willing to play defense. Hannan might be their only actual defensive minded defenseman. Green has no interest in playing defense and never has. The fact that he has been nominated for the Norris illustrates why most NHL awards are a joke simply based on stat lines rather than play.
    3) Bruce Bordreau: I think he is a good, maybe great, coach. He does however make some questionable coaching blunders like putting Ovie in the box to serve a team penalty during a 4 on 4 in Game 3. he deserves credit for how he got the Caps turned around in the second half of the season with their renewed emphasis on defense which evaporated in the playoffs.
    4) Every forward not name Ovechkin-Really, he was the only one who showed up and played hard.

    Pierre McGuire said the first thing I have ever agreed with him on right after the St Louis goal when they replayed Semin whining to the ref and gliding to the bench resulting in St Louis' break away goal. McGuire said that the GM of the Caps should really consider not bringing Semin back because of the constant attitude and selfishness he shows on plays like that. I completely agree.
